Behind the scenes of Revolution...
The Revolution music video was created by Eklectyk Creative Media for the Napalm Clique. The song lyrics and the original interview with Fred Hampton Jr. inspired a short story about the power of using hip hop in the classroom. The video blends imagery of history's revolutionaries with a vision of present day hip hop, reminding us of the necessary connection between hip hop and social change.

The video was shot in HD at the California College of the Arts (CCA), in Oakland, CA using a Panasonic HVX.
